package com.ebmwebsourcing.easycommons.io;
import java.io.BufferedReader;
import java.io.Closeable;
import java.io.File;
import java.io.FileInputStream;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.InputStreamReader;
import com.ebmwebsourcing.easycommons.lang.UncheckedException;
/**
* @author Marc Jambert - EBM WebSourcing
*/
public class IOHelper {
private static final byte[] EMPTY_BYTE_ARRAY = new byte[0];
private IOHelper() {
}
public static void close(Closeable closeable) {
if (closeable == null)
return;
try {
closeable.close();
} catch (IOException e) {
throw new UncheckedException(String.format(
"Cannot close object of class '%s'.", closeable.getClass()
.getSimpleName()));
}
}
/**
* Get the line of the specified file corresponding to the specified line
* number. Each time this method is called, the file is open, read until the
* specified line number and closed.
*
* @param file
* the file to read the line
* @param lineNum
* the number of the line in the specified file
* @return a String containing the contents of the line, not including any
* line-termination characters, or null if the specified line number
* is greater than the line number of the file
*
* @throws IOException
* if the file does not exist, is a directory rather than a
* regular file, or for some other reason cannot be opened for
* reading, if a security manager exists and its checkRead
* method denies read access to the file or if an I/O error
* occurs
*/
public static final String getLine(File file, int lineNum) throws IOException {
assert file != null;
assert lineNum > 0;
String strLine = null;
BufferedReader br = null;
try {
br = new BufferedReader(new InputStreamReader(new FileInputStream(file)));
int counter = 1;
strLine = br.readLine();
while (strLine != null && counter < lineNum) {
strLine = br.readLine();
counter++;
}
} finally {
if (br != null) {
br.close();
}
}
return strLine;
}
/**
* Read the specified file
*
* @param file
* the file to read
*
* @return the content of the file
*
* @throws IOException
* if the file does not exist, is a directory rather than a
* regular file, or for some other reason cannot be opened for
* reading, if a security manager exists and its checkRead
* method denies read access to the file or if an I/O error
* occurs
*/
public static final String readFileAsString(File file) throws IOException {
return new String(readFileAsBytes(file));
}
public static byte[] readFileAsBytes(File file) throws IOException {
assert file != null;
if (file.canRead() && (file.length() == 0)) return EMPTY_BYTE_ARRAY;
FileInputStream fis = null;
try {
fis = new FileInputStream(file);
byte[] readBytes = new byte[(int) file.length()];
int nbRead = fis.read(readBytes);
assert nbRead == readBytes.length;
return readBytes;
} finally {
IOHelper.close(fis);
}
}
}
